  1. Global 5500; 6500 By Bombardier Timetabled For 2019
    Bombardier has given a concrete timeline to the entry-into-service (EIS) for the new generation of Globals, the Global 5500 and 6500. Speaking at the 2018 NBAA-BACE the Canadian airframer says that flight testing for the updated models of the Global 5000 (now Global 5500) and Global 6000 (now Global 6500) is approximately 70 percent completed and therefore should easily allow them to be certificated and enter service towards the back-end of 2019.
  2. "The flight test team feels privileged to execute another program for such superior aircraft," said Tom Bisges, Vice President, Bombardier Flight Test Centre and Flight Operations. "The Global 5500 and 6500 aircraft flight test program is proceeding smoothly, and we find that our extensive experience testing the Global 7500 aircraft, as well as the quality of these newest aircraft, allow us to continue to execute on schedule." The new planes will have a number of upgrades including Bombardier’s advanced Vision flight deck which is according to Bombardier, the first true combined vision system (CVS) in business aviation – the only system to seamlessly merge enhanced and synthetic images in a single view. The Global 5500 and Global 6500 aircraft have class-leading ranges of 5,700 and 6,600 nautical miles, respectively. These are a few of the updates made to the new Global aircraft.
